Energy stored in an inductor is ________(a) LI(b) LI^2(c) LI/2(d) LI^2/2This question was addressed to me during an interview.My question comes from Basic Network Concepts in portion Circuit Elements and Kirchhoff’s Laws of Network Theory

Answer»

The CORRECT choice is (d) LI^2/2

The best explanation: V = L \(\frac{di}{DT}\)

DE = Vidt = L \(\frac{di}{dt} IDT\) = Lidt

E = \(\int_0^I dE = \int_0^I Lidt = \frac{1}{2} LI^2\).
